The CAGED system helps you map the the whole guitar neck with just five memorable chord shapes. Once memorised, you can use these shapes as an "anchor" to store your licks, scales and arpeggios to become a fluid, unstoppable rock guitar soloist. Rock Guitar Un-CAGED includes 100 original rock guitar licks based around the 5 CAGED system shapes, and full explanations of how to open up the whole guitar neck in any key, in any position. The Complete Rock Guitar Soloing Course. There are 25 Licks based around each of the 4 most common rock guitar scales; The Blues Scale, The Aeolian Mode, The Lydian Mode and the Mixolydian Mode. With 5 licks based around each of the 5 fretboard positions you instantly learn exciting licks to play wherever you are on the guitar neck. Each lick is demonstrated with a professionally recorded example track so you know what sound you're aiming for. Learn the guitar fretboard in a creative, exciting way. The CAGED system teaches you easily relate each scale pattern to chord shape anchors so that you can easily play any scale or lick, in any position and in any key by simply moving the chord shape.
